There is one exception but with tax restrictions: owning vintage vehicles.
Here you can have up to three vintage vehicles (cars or scooters / motorbikes) before returning to the tax authorities which cross-reference the data on your income with the "estimated expense" on maintaining them.
With only one (reduced) insurance you can insure three but drive only one at a time and only the owner can drive it; the annual property vehicle tax is symbolic (EUR 11) or zero and depends on the region you live in.
Two-wheeled vehicles must be over twenty years old and be included in special lists and / or checked by traveling commissions that issue a certificate and, for better restored vehicles, also a gold-colored metal plate with vehicle data and a number registration in a national historical register.
For cars the same thing happens but they must be more than thirty years old from the first registration.
The control overhaul of the bodywork and mechanics is done every two years at few authorized workshops.
